The cheapest way to get from New Delhi (Station) to Shillong is to train and taxi which costs ₹2,500 - ₹8,500 and takes 28h 30m.
The fastest way to get from New Delhi (Station) to Shillong is to fly which takes 5h 35m and costs ₹10,000 - ₹24,000.
No, there is no direct bus from New Delhi (Station) station to Shillong. However, there are services departing from New Delhi Station Gate 1 and arriving at Shillong, Meghalaya via Karol Bagh Terminal, Delhi, Delhi State, Patna and Guwahati, Assam.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 45h 29m.
The distance between New Delhi (Station) and Shillong is 1558 km. The road distance is 1838.8 km.

Spicejet and IndiGo Airlines fly from Indira Gandhi International Airport (DEL) to Umroi Airport (SHL) 3 times a day.
